Overcast skies and wet grounds limited on field activities this morning while I was at the Complex.  Players were out for a few individualized drills however all the work was done in the outfield areas.  There’s a drill with a football that we saw Gabriel Rincones & Jordan Viars working on - from my perspective it’s designed to help with other the shoulder catches and route running on fly balls.


A few of the pitchers were out on Carlton Field for stretching and long tossing - multiple players went thru warmups and sprints on Roberts Field.  Hitting was likely indoors in the Montgomery Center as tarps covered the home plate area on all four fields.

The Phillies Player Development site posted the camp roster - see below.


Domincan Summer League ( DSL ) Contingent


The roster includes 7 pitchers, 1 infielder and 3 outfielders from the Dominican Academy.  Infielder Marco Soto ( 18 yrs old ) is the youngest player in the contingent - he had a very solid season played for Phillies Red and was transferred to the Phillies White roster for the playoff/championship run.   Jorge Garcia ( a league all-star ), Raylin Heredia ( championship series star ) and Darium Gutierrez ( power bat from Cuba ) are outfielders who stood out this summer in the DSL brought up for camp.


RHP Jonh Henriquez is in the group - he was consistently in the upper 90’s this season - a power arm discovery this summer.  RHP Jesus Querales was selected to play in the 2022 DSL All-Star game - he performed as a closer this season - arsenal features a fastball that can run into the mid nineties.  RHP Saul Teran and RHP Pedro Reyes are two more pitchers that have displayed mid nineties fastballs and RHP Fernando Ortega is a big fella ( 6’5” ) that’s shown pitch mixes that are intriguing.


RHP Danyony Pulido features a FB sitting in the 91 to 93 mph range and has shown flashes that go higher along with a slider and curve.  RHP Luis Gomez appeared in 14 games for DSL Red - 5 as a starter.


A couple BlueClaws :


Infielder Hao Yu Lee who missed time this summer due to injury and is just 19 years old is in camp for more reps to finish the season.  Catcher Anthony Quirion is also in camp, he too had a bit of down time this summer due to a hand injury.


FCL Guys :


Outfielders Jordan Viars, Yemal Flores and Gavin Tonkel are all in camp as is infielder Nikau Pouaka-Grego - all are teenagers.

LHP  Samuel Aldegheri is also here - the hurler from Italy lost a good bit of the season to injury so being in camp will make up for lost time.
